Maxi averaged 35.2 points in the first five games of the season, the highest average since James Harden in the 2019-20 season.

November 1st - In the NBA Cup group stage, the 76ers lost to the Celtics 108-109.


In the game, 76ers player Tyrese Maxey played 44 minutes, scoring 26 points, grabbing 8 rebounds, dishing out 14 assists, making 2 steals, and blocking 2 shots, shooting 8-for-16 from the field.


According to statistics, Maxey averaged 35.2 points in the first five games of the preseason. The last player to score more points in the first five games of a season was James Harden in the 2019-20 season (36.6 points per game).
